Orzotto With Spring Ramps & Goat Cheese

  1. Bring 1 quart of salted water to a boil.
  2. Meanwhile separate the bulb end of the ramps from the leafy green part. Save the bulbs ends for another use. Roll the leaves and cut them into a chiffonade.
  3. When the water is boiling add the orzo, reduce the heat to medium-low to gently boil for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ally until the water is almost all absorbed. Add the ramps and stir until wilted. Stir in the ramp butter. Using a microplane, add the zest of 1/2 a lemon and several grinds of black pepper.
  4. Transfer to serving plates and top with crumbled goat cheese.
